Summary/Abstract: Article tracks activities of unofficial Polish Army “Brygada Świętokrzyszka“ at the end of the Second World War, and particularly its reflection in memories. Army “Brygada Świętokrzyszka“ intervened in a concentration camp Holysov even a few hours before the arrival of Allied troops and liberated the prisoners interned here. There are difference portraits of Polish in memories, it is an another proof of its controversity.
